Subject: [Ocfs2-devel] [PATCH] ocfs2: add the missing return value check of ocfs2_get_clusters

In ocfs2_attach_refcount_tree() and ocfs2_duplicate_extent_list(), if
error occurs when calling ocfs2_get_clusters(), it will go with
unexpected behavior as local variables p_cluster, num_clusters and
ext_flags are declared without initialization.

fs/ocfs2/refcounttree.c | 8 ++++++++
1 file changed, 8 insertions(+)
diff --git a/fs/ocfs2/refcounttree.c b/fs/ocfs2/refcounttree.c
index 998b17e..3589ec1 100644
--- a/fs/ocfs2/refcounttree.c
+++ b/fs/ocfs2/refcounttree.c
@@ -3886,6 +3886,10 @@ static int ocfs2_attach_refcount_tree(struct
inode *inode,
while (cpos < clusters) {
ret = ocfs2_get_clusters(inode, cpos, &p_cluster,
&num_clusters, &ext_flags);
+ if (ret) {
+ mlog_errno(ret);
+ goto unlock;
+ }
if (p_cluster && !(ext_flags & OCFS2_EXT_REFCOUNTED)) {
ret = ocfs2_add_refcount_flag(inode, &di_et,
@@ -4057,6 +4061,10 @@ static int ocfs2_duplicate_extent_list(struct
inode *s_inode,
while (cpos < clusters) {
ret = ocfs2_get_clusters(s_inode, cpos, &p_cluster,
&num_clusters, &ext_flags);
+ if (ret) {
+ mlog_errno(ret);
+ goto out;
+ }
if (p_cluster) {
ret = ocfs2_add_refcounted_extent(t_inode, &et,
